Deputy Minister Visits SMTI – A Promising Future for Seafarers and the Marine Industry!

On 6th February 2025, Deputy Minister of Ports, Shipping, and Aviation, Eng. Janitha Ruwan Kodithuwakku, visited Southern Maritime Training Institute (SMTI) and pledged his unwavering support to the private sector in strengthening Sri Lanka’s seafaring workforce.

The Deputy Minister emphasized the crucial role of private maritime training institutions in building the country’s global maritime presence. With the regulatory authority actively supporting growth and development, this collaboration signals a bright and promising future for the industry.
